Has anyone heard anything " bad " associated with using Bragg's Liquid Amino Acid?

I have several recipes that call for it - it's supposed to be a good unfermented

substitute for soy sauce. I called the company to ask them how it's made and

the representative said it is made from soaking soybeans in plain distilled

water and that's it. I asked if the beans are blended with the water and the

irritated response was " NO. " I just couldn't understand how the

" no-sodium-added " Bragg's could taste so salty from just soaking soybeans in it.
